Directorate of Enforcement Vs M. Gopal Reddy & Anr (Supreme Court of India) Supreme Court of India held that conditions under Section 45 Prevention of Money Laundering Act, 2002 (PMLA) is applicable to Anticipatory Bail application under section 438 of The Code of Criminal Procedure, 1973. Facts- A FIR was registered by Economic Offences Wing (EOW), wherein 20 persons/companies were named as suspected in the said scam. M/s Max Mantena Micro JV, Hyderabad was one among them.
